金口若望

詩篇註釋 第 17 章

希臘文原文.135 節.此語言尚無詞彙資料

17:1
Εἰς τὸ τέλος ὑπὲρ τῶν υἱῶν Κορὲ, ὑπὲρ τῶν κρυ φίων
「交與伶長,為可拉的子孫,論隱祕的事。」
'To the end, for the sons of Korah, concerning the hidden things.'
17:2
Ἄλλος, Τῷ νικοποιῷ τῶν υἱῶν Κορέ
另一位譯作:「歸與那賜勝利者,屬可拉子孫的。」
Another, 'To the giver of victory, of the sons of Korah.'
17:3
Ἄλλος, Ὑπὲρ νεοτήτων ᾆσμα
另一位譯作:「論少年人的一首歌。」
Another, 'A song concerning youths.'
17:4
Θεὸς ἡμῶν καταφυγὴ καὶ δύναμις, βοηθὸς ἐν θλίψεσι, ταῖς εὑρούσαις ἡμᾶς σφόδρα
「神是我們的避難所,是我們的力量,是我們在患難中隨時的幫助,就是那極其臨到我們的患難中。」
'Our God is a refuge and strength, a helper in the afflictions that have found us exceedingly.'
17:5
Ἄλλος, Ἐν θλίψεσιν εὑρισκόμενος
另一位譯作:「在患難中被尋見。」
Another, 'Being found in afflictions.'
17:6
Διὰ τοῦτο οὐ φο βηθησόμεθα ἐν τῷ ταράσσεσθαι τὴν γῆν, καὶ μετατίθεσθαι ὄρη ἐν καρδίαις θαλασσῶν
「因此,地雖搖動,山雖挪移到海心,我們也不害怕。」
'Therefore we will not fear when the earth is shaken and the mountains are removed into the hearts of the seas.'
17:7
Τῇ συνήθει κέχρηται φιλοσοφίᾳ προφήτης, τῶν μὲν βιωτικῶν ἀπάγων πραγμάτων, εἰς δὲ τὴν ἐλπίδα τὴν ἄνωθεν ἀνάγων τὸν ἀκροατήν
先知運用他慣常的智慧之道,把聽者從今世的事務中領開,向上提升到那從上頭而來的盼望。
The prophet employs his customary philosophy, leading the hearer away from the affairs of this life and raising him up to the hope from above.
17:8
Μὴ γάρ μοι ὅπλα καὶ τείχη καὶ τάφρους εἴπῃς, φησὶ, μηδὲ περιουσίαν. χρημάτων, καὶ πολεμικῶν ἐμπειρίαν, καὶ πλῆθος ἵππων, μηδὲ τόξα, καὶ βέλη, καὶ θώρακας, μηδὲ συμμάχων πλήθη, καὶ στρατιωτῶν φάλαγγας, μηδὲ σώματος ἰσχὺν, καὶ πολεμίων πεῖραν
他說:不要向我提起兵器、城牆與壕溝,也不要提財貨的豐足、作戰的經驗與眾多的馬匹,不要提弓箭與胸甲,不要提盟軍的眾多與士兵的方陣,也不要提身體的力量與對敵作戰的老練。
For do not speak to me, he says, of arms and walls and trenches, nor of abundance of wealth and experience in warfare and a multitude of horses, nor of bows and arrows and breastplates, nor of throngs of allies and phalanxes of soldiers, nor of bodily strength and experience of enemies.
17:9
Πάντα ταῦτα ἀράχνης καὶ σκιᾶς ἀδρανέστερα
這一切都比蛛網和影子更加虛弱無力。
All these things are feebler than a spider's web and a shadow.
17:10
Ἀλλ' εἰ βούλει τὴν ἄμαχον ἰδεῖν δύναμιν, τὴν καταφυγὴν τὴν ἀχείρωτον, τὸ φρούριον τὸ ἄσυλον, τὸν πύργον τὸν ἄσειστον, ἐπὶ τὸν Θεὸν κατάφευγε, ἐκείνην ἐπισπῶ τὴν ἰσχύν
但你若想要看見那無敵的能力、那攻不破的避難所、那不可侵犯的堡壘、那搖撼不動的高臺,就當投奔神,把那力量吸取到自己身上。
But if you wish to behold the invincible power, the refuge that cannot be overcome, the fortress that gives sanctuary, the tower that cannot be shaken, flee to God, and draw to yourself that strength.
17:11
Καὶ καλῶς εἶπεν, Θεὸς ἡμῶν καταφυγὴ καὶ δύναμις·
他說得好:「神是我們的避難所,是我們的力量」;
And well did he say, 'Our God is a refuge and strength';
17:12
δεικνὺς ὅτι ποτὲ μὲν φεύγοντες νικῶμεν, ποτὲ δὲ ἱστάμενοι καὶ πολεμοῦντες
以此表明:我們有時藉著退避得勝,有時則藉著站穩爭戰得勝。
showing that at times we conquer by fleeing, and at other times by standing firm and doing battle.
17:13
Καὶ γὰρ ἀμφότερα ταῦτα δεῖ ποιεῖν, καὶ ὁμόσε χωρεῖν, καὶ ἐκκλίνειν
因為這兩樣我們都必須做——既要與敵短兵相接,也要適時避讓。
For indeed we must do both these things—both close with the foe and turn aside.
17:14
Τοῦτο καὶ Παῦλος ἐποίει, ποτὲ μὲν ὑποχωρῶν, ποτὲ δὲ ἐπεμβαίνων τοῖς ἐναντιουμένοις τῷ λόγῳ τῆς ἀληθείας
保羅也是這樣行:有時退讓,有時卻進逼那些抵擋真理之道的人。
This Paul also did, at one time withdrawing, at another time pressing upon those who set themselves against the word of the truth.
17:15
Τοῦτο καὶ Χριστὸς ἐποίει διδάσκων ἡμᾶς·
基督也是這樣行,藉此教導我們;
This Christ also did, teaching us;
17:16
ποιεῖν, καὶ εἰδέναι μετὰ ἀκριβείας καιρῶν ἐπιτηδειότητα, καὶ εὔχεσθαι μὲν μὴ εἰσελθεῖν εἰς πειρασμὸν κατὰ τὸ λόγιον ἐκεῖνο τὸ εὐαγγελικόν·
教我們如何行事,並準確地辨明時機是否合宜,且要照那福音的話語祈求不叫我們遇見試探;
to act, and to know with exactness the fitness of occasions, and indeed to pray not to enter into temptation, according to that Gospel saying;
17:17
παραγενομένου δὲ, μὴ μαλακίζεσθαι, ἀλλ' ἑστάναι γενναίως
但當試探臨到時,卻不可軟弱畏縮,乃要勇敢站立。
but when it has come upon us, not to grow soft, but to stand nobly.
17:18
Βοηθὸς ἐν θλίψεσι ταῖς εὑρούσαις ἡμᾶς σφόδρα
「在那極其臨到我們的患難中隨時的幫助。」
'A helper in the afflictions that have found us exceedingly.'
17:19
πολλάκις εἶπον, καὶ νῦν λέγω
我屢次說過的話,如今我再說一次。
What I have often said, I say now also.
17:20
Οὐ κωλύει τὰς θλίψεις ἐπελθεῖν, ἀλλὰ παραγενομένων παρίσταται, χρησίμους ἡμᾶς ἐργαζόμενος καὶ δοκίμους
祂並不阻止患難臨到我們,卻在患難來到時與我們同在,使我們成為有用且經得起考驗的人。
He does not prevent the afflictions from coming upon us, but stands by us when they have come, rendering us useful and approved.
17:21
Τὸ δὲ Σφόδρα τῷ Βοηθὸς προσνεμητέον
而「極其」一詞當歸屬於「幫助」這詞。
And the word 'exceedingly' is to be attached to 'helper.'
17:22
Καὶ γὰρ οὐχ ὡς ἔτυχε βοηθεῖ, ἀλλὰ μετὰ τῆς ὑπερβολῆς, πλείονα παρέχων τὴν ἀπὸ τῆς συμμαχίας παράκλησιν τῆς ἀπὸ τῶν θλίψεων ὀδύνης
因為祂並非只以尋常的方式施助,而是超乎尋常地相助,祂藉著這同盟所賜的安慰,遠勝過我們從患難所受的痛苦。
For He does not help in a merely ordinary way, but with abundance beyond measure, supplying a consolation from His alliance greater than the pain that comes from our afflictions.
17:23
Οὐ γὰρ ὅσον ἀπαιτεῖ τῶν δεινῶν φύσις, τοσαύτην ἡμῖν παρέχει τὴν συμμαχίαν, ἀλλὰ πολλῷ πλείονα
因為祂所賜給我們的援助,並非僅按危難本身所要求的程度,而是遠遠超過。
For He does not grant us aid only in the measure that the nature of our dangers demands, but far more abundantly.
17:24
Διὰ τοῦτο οὐ φοβηθησόμεθα, φησὶν, ἐν τῷ ταράσσεσθαι τὴν γῆν
他說,正因如此,縱使大地震動,我們也必不懼怕。
For this reason, he says, we will not be afraid, though the earth be shaken.
17:25
Ὁρᾷς πῶς πλείονα παρέχει τὴν βοήθειαν, καὶ ἐκ πολλῆς τῆς περιουσίας; Οὐ γὰρ εἶπεν, Οὐ μόνον οὐχ ἁλωσόμεθα, οὐδὲ πεσούμεθα, ἀλλ' Οὐδὲ κοινὸν τῆς φύσεώς ἐστι πεισόμεθα, τὸ φοβηθῆναι καὶ δεῖσαι
你看見祂如何格外豐盛地、從極大的充裕中施予援助嗎?他並沒有說:「我們不僅不被擄掠,也不跌倒」,而是說:「我們甚至不會受那本屬人性所共有的——就是懼怕與戰兢。」
Do you see how He supplies aid in greater measure, and out of great abundance? For he did not say, 'We shall not only not be taken captive, nor fall,' but 'We shall not even suffer that which is common to our nature—namely, to be afraid and to tremble.'
17:26
Πόθεν δὲ τοῦτο γίνεται; Ἐκ τοῦ τὴν συμμαχίαν ἐκ περιουσίας ἐπιέναι
這是從何而來的呢?是因為祂的相助乃是從豐盈中臨到我們。
And whence does this come about? From the fact that His alliance comes upon us out of abundance.
17:27
Γῆν δὲ ἐνταῦθα, καὶ ὄρη, καὶ καρδίαν θαλασσῶν, οὐ τὰ στοιχεῖά φησιν, ἀλλὰ τῷ ὀνόματι τούτων τοὺς ἀφορήτους κινδύνους αἰνίττεται
他在此所說的「地」、「山」與「海心」,並非指那些物質的元素,而是藉這些名稱,隱喻那些難以忍受的危險。
By 'earth' here, and 'mountains,' and 'the heart of the seas,' he does not mean the physical elements, but under these names he hints at unbearable dangers.
17:28
Κἂν πάντα ἴδωμεν συγκεχυμένα, φησὶ, κἂν ταραχὴν ἀφόρητον, κἂν ταῦτα συμβαίνοντα, μηδέποτε γέγονε, κἂν αὐτὴν, ὡς ἂν εἴποι τις, τὴν κτίσιν συῤῥηγνυμένην ἑαυτῇ, καὶ τοὺς τῆς φύσεως κινουμένους ὅρους, καὶ πάντα ἐκ βάθρων ἀνασπώμενα, καὶ τὰ πρῶτα στοιχεῖα συγχεόμενα, καὶ τοσαύτην γινομένην τὴν ταραχὴν, οὐ μόνον οὐχ ἁλωσόμεθα, ἀλλ' οὐδὲ δείσομεν
他說,縱然我們看見萬物陷入混亂,看見難以忍受的動盪,看見從未發生過的事臨到,甚至——如人所說——受造界本身自相崩裂,自然的界限被挪移,萬物從根基被拔起,那最初的元素被攪亂,如此巨大的動盪興起——我們卻不僅不被擄掠,甚至也不懼怕。
Even if we should see all things thrown into confusion, he says, and an unbearable turmoil, and things happening that have never happened before—even, as one might say, creation itself bursting asunder against itself, and the bounds of nature dislodged, and everything torn up from its foundations, and the primal elements confounded, and so great a turmoil arising—yet we shall not only not be taken captive, but we shall not even be afraid.
17:29
Τὸ δὲ αἴτιον, ὅτι πάντων τούτων Δεσπότης βοηθεῖ, καὶ χεῖρα ὀρέγει, καὶ παρίσταται
其緣由在於:這萬有的主宰幫助我們,向我們伸出手來,並站在我們身旁。
And the reason is that the Master of all these things helps us, and stretches out His hand, and stands beside us.
17:30
Εἰ δὲ τούτων γινομένων οὐκ ἂν ἐνδοίημεν, οὐδὲ καταμαλακισθείημεν·
然而,若在這些事臨到時,我們尚且不退縮,也不軟弱,
But if, when these things happen, we would not give way nor be enfeebled,
17:31
πολλῷ μᾶλλον ἐπιόντων τῶν ἐχθρῶν, καὶ τῶν πολεμίων παραταττομένων
那麼,當仇敵進逼、敵軍列陣時,我們就更加如此了。
how much more so when enemies advance, and when foes are marshalled in battle-array.
17:32
Ἤχησαν καὶ ἐταράχθησαν τὰ ὕδατα αὐτῶν
他們的眾水澎湃翻騰。
Their waters roared and were troubled.
17:33
Ἐταράχθησαν τὰ ὄρη ἐν τῇ κραταιότητι αὐτοῦ
眾山因祂的大能而震動。
The mountains were troubled by His might.
17:34
Ἠχούντων καὶ θολουμένων τῶν ὑδάτων, καὶ σειομένων ὀρέων ἐν τῷ ἐνδοξασμῷ αὐτοῦ
當眾水澎湃混濁、眾山因祂的榮耀而搖撼之時。
While the waters roared and were made turbid, and the mountains shook in His glorious majesty.
17:35
Εἰπὼν, ὅτι οὐ δείσομεν συῤῥηγνυμένων ἁπάντων, λοιπὸν περὶ τῆς δυνάμεως αὐτοῦ διαλέγεται, ὅτι ἄμαχος αὐτοῦ ἰσχύς
他既說了縱使萬物崩裂我們也必不懼怕,接著便論到祂的能力,說祂的力量是無可抵擋的。
Having said that we shall not be afraid though all things burst asunder, he then goes on to discourse concerning His power—that His might is invincible.
17:36
Καὶ εἰκότως φησὶν, οὐ δεδοίκαμεν, καὶ ὅπερ ἀεὶ ποιεῖ, νῦν. μὲν ἀπὸ τῆς κτίσεως, νῦν δὲ ἀπὸ τῶν τοῖς ἀνθρώποις συμβαινόντων ἀνακηρύττει αὐτοῦ τὴν ἰσχὺν, τοῦτο καὶ ἐνταῦθα ποιεῖ
他這樣說「我們並不懼怕」是理所當然的;祂素常所行的,如今也照樣行:有時祂從受造界宣揚祂的力量,有時則從臨到世人身上的事來宣揚——祂在此處也是如此。
And with good reason he says, 'We have not been afraid'; and what He always does, He does now also: at one time He proclaims His might from creation, at another from the things that befall men—this too He does here.
17:37
δὲ λέγει τοιοῦτόν ἐστι·
他所說的意思乃是這樣:
And what he means is this:
17:38
Σείει πάντα, σαλεύει, μετατίθησιν, ὅταν βούληται·
祂震動萬物,搖撼萬物,遷移萬物,隨祂所願而行;
He shakes all things, He makes them quake, He removes them, whenever He wills;
17:39
οὕτως αὐτῷ ῥᾴδια καὶ εὔκολα πάντα
萬事對祂都是如此輕而易舉、毫不費力。
so easy and effortless are all things to Him.
17:40
Ἐμοὶ δὲ δοκεῖ τὰ πλήθη ἐνταῦθα αἰνίττεσθαι τῶν ἀνδρείων, καὶ τοὺς ὑψηλοὺς τῶν πολεμίων, καὶ τὸν ἄπειρον λαὸν τῶν ἐναντίων
但在我看來,他在此隱喻那眾多的勇士、敵人中那些高傲的人,以及仇敵那不可勝數的群眾。
But it seems to me that here he hints at the multitudes of the valiant, and the lofty ones among the foes, and the countless host of the adversaries.
17:41
Τοσαύτη γὰρ αὐτοῦ δύναμις, φησὶν, ὡς ἁπλῶς νεῦσαι, καὶ ταῦτα πάντα γίνεσθαι
他說,祂的能力是如此浩大,只需祂略一頷首,這一切便都成就了。
For so great is His power, he says, that with a mere nod all these things come to pass.
17:42
Πῶς οὖν δυνάμεθα φοβεῖσθαι τοιοῦτον ἔχοντες Δεσπότην; Διάψαλμα
既有這樣一位主宰,我們又怎能懼怕呢?(細拉)
How then can we be afraid, having such a Master? Selah.
17:43
Εὐφραίνουσι τὴν πόλιν τοῦ Θεοῦ·
他們使神的城歡喜快樂;
They make glad the city of God;
17:44
ἡγίασε τὸ σκήνωμα αὐτοῦ Ὕψιστος
至高者已使祂的居所成聖。
the Most High has hallowed His tabernacle.
17:45
Ἄλλος φησὶ, Τὸ ἅγιον τῆς κατασκηνώσεως τοῦ Ὑψίστου
另一位譯者說:「至高者所居之聖所。」
Another translator says, 'The holy place of the dwelling of the Most High.'
17:46
Θεὸς ἐν μέσῳ αὐτῆς, καὶ οὐ σαλευθήσεται
神在她中間,她必不動搖。
God is in the midst of her, and she shall not be moved.
17:47
Βοηθήσει αὐτῇ Θεὸς τῷ πρὸς πρωῒ πρωΐ
到天亮的時候,神必幫助她。
God will help her early, at the dawning of the morning.
17:48
Ἄλλος φησὶ, Περὶ τὸν ὄρθρον
另一位說:「約在破曉之時。」
Another says, 'About daybreak.'
17:49
Εἰπὼν περὶ τῆς δυνάμεως αὐτοῦ καὶ τῆς ἰσχύος, καὶ ὅτι ῥᾴδια αὐτῷ πάντα, εἰς τὴν τῆς Ἰουδαϊκῆς προνοίας ὑπόθεσιν μετατίθησι τὸν λόγον, τὰ δεδομένα αὐτοῖς ἀγαθὰ διὰ βραχέων λέξεων παριστάς
他既論到祂的能力與力量,也論到萬事對祂都是輕而易舉的,便將話語轉到神眷顧猶太人的主題上,以寥寥數語陳明所賜給他們的美善。
Having spoken of His power and might, and that all things are easy for Him, he transfers his discourse to the theme of the providential care shown to the Jews, setting forth in a few words the good things granted to them.
17:50
Οὗτος γὰρ, οὕτω δυνατὸς, οὕτως ἰσχυρὸς καὶ φοβερὸς, καὶ πάντα ἄγων καὶ φέρων, πάντα σείων καὶ κινῶν, καὶ μετατιθεὶς καὶ μεθιστὰς, μυρίων τὴν πόλιν ἡμῶν ἐνέπλησεν ἀγαθῶν
因為這位——如此有能、如此強盛可畏、統管並承載萬物、震動並挪移萬物、遷移並移除萬物的主——使我們的城充滿了無數的美善。
For this One—so powerful, so mighty and awesome, who leads and carries all things, who shakes and moves all things, who transfers and removes them—filled our city with countless good things.
17:51
Ποταμὸς γὰρ ἐνταῦθα τὸ δαψιλὲς τῆς χορηγίας τῶν ἄνωθεν δωρεῶν, καὶ τὸ ἀκώλυτον καὶ τὸ ἐκκεχυμένον παρίστησιν, ὡσανεὶ ἔλεγε·
因為此處的「河」,代表那從上頭而來的恩賜供應之豐沛,以及其暢通無阻、傾流而下的充盈,彷彿他在說:
For the 'river' here represents the lavishness of the supply of gifts from above, and their unhindered and outpoured abundance, as though he were saying:
17:52
Καθάπερ ἐκ πηγῶν ἡμῖν ἅπαντα ἐπιῤῥεῖ τὰ ἀγαθά
一切美善都如泉源般湧流到我們這裡。
As from fountains, all good things flow to us.
17:53
Ὥσπερ γὰρ ποταμὸς εἰς μυρία σχιζόμενος μέρη, τὴν ὑποκειμένην ἄρδει χώραν·
因為正如一條河分為無數支流,灌溉其下所延展的地土;
For just as a river, dividing into countless branches, waters the land that lies beneath it;
17:54
οὕτως τοῦ Θεοῦ πρόνοια πανταχόθεν ἐπιῤῥεῖ, δαψιλῶς φερομένη, καὶ ῥοιζηδὸν ἐπιοῦσα, καὶ πάντα πληροῦσα
神的眷顧也照樣從四面八方湧流而入,豐豐富富地流動,轟然奔騰而來,充滿萬有。
so the providence of God flows in from every side, borne along lavishly, rushing on with a roar, and filling all things.
17:55
δὲ παρέχει μόνον ἡμῖν, οὐδὲ βοήθειαν ἀῤῥαγῆ, ἀλλὰ καὶ πνευματικὴν χαράν·
祂所賜給我們的,不僅是這些,也不僅是那牢不可破的幫助,更有屬靈的喜樂;
And He grants us not only this, nor an unbreakable help alone, but also spiritual joy;
17:56
Ἡγίασε τὸ σκήνωμα αὐτοῦ Ὕψιστος
至高者已使祂的居所成聖。
The Most High has hallowed His tabernacle.
17:57
Καὶ τοῦτο δὲ εὐεργεσίας αὐτὸ μέρος οὐ μικρὸν, τὸ σκήνωμα αὐτοῦ καλέσαι τὸν τόπον
這也是祂恩惠中不小的一部分——就是祂稱那地方為祂的居所。
And this too is no small part of His beneficence—that He called the place His tabernacle.
17:58
Καὶ οὐχ ἁπλῶς τέθεικε τὸ, Ὕψιστος
他加上「至高者」這幾個字,也並非沒有用意。
And not without purpose has he added the words, 'The Most High.'
17:59
οὖνοὕτως ὑψηλὸς, μηδενὶ τόπῳ περιεχόμενος, ἄφραστος οὐσία, κατηξίωσε σκήνωμα αὐτοῦ καλέσαι τὴν πόλιν τὴν ἡμετέραν, καὶ πάντοθεν αὐτὴν συνέχει
那麼,這位如此崇高、不被任何處所所容納、那不可言喻的本體,竟俯就地稱我們的城為祂的居所,並從四面八方將她維繫在一起。
He, then, who is so exalted, who is contained by no place, the ineffable Being, deigned to call our city His tabernacle, and holds it together on every side.
17:60
Τοῦτο γὰρ ἔστιν, Ἐν μέσῳ αὐτῆς, ὡς καὶ ἀλλαχοῦ λέγει·
「在她中間」正是這個意思,正如他在別處也說:
For this is what 'in the midst of her' means, as he says also elsewhere:
17:61
Πάντοθεν αὐτὴν συγκροτεῖ·
祂從四面八方將她牢牢地聯結在一起。
He holds her firmly together on every side.
17:62
διὰ τοῦτο οὐ μόνον οὐδὲν πείσεται δεινὸν, ἀλλ' οὐδὲ σαλευθήσεται
因此他不僅不會遭遇任何可怕之事,甚至也不會被動搖。
Therefore he will not only suffer nothing dreadful, but he will not even be shaken.
17:63
Καὶ τὸ αἴτιον, ὅτι ταχίστης ἀπολαύει τῆς συμμαχίας, ἑτοίμου καὶ παρεσκευασμένης οὔσης·
其緣由在於,他享有最迅速的援助,那援助是現成的、預備妥當的;
And the reason is that he enjoys the swiftest alliance, one that is ready and prepared;
17:64
οὐ μελλούσης, οὐδὲ βραδυνούσης, ἀλλὰ νεαρᾶς ἀεὶ καὶ ἀκμαζούσης, καὶ ἐν καιρῷ τῷ προσήκοντι
並非遲延的,也非緩慢的,而是常常煥然如新、生氣勃勃的,且在合宜的時刻臨到。
not tardy, nor slow, but ever fresh and vigorous, and at the fitting moment.
17:65
Ἔδωκε φωνὴν αὐτοῦ Ὕψιστος, ἐσαλεύθη γῆ
「至高者發出祂的聲音,地就震動了。」
'The Most High gave forth His voice, the earth was shaken.'
17:66
Δείκνυσιν αὐτοῦ τῆς βοηθείας ἐνταῦθα τὴν δύναμιν
在此他顯明了祂幫助的能力。
Here he displays the power of His help.
17:67
Οὐ γὰρ δὴ τῶν τυχόντων ἐπιόντων, ἀλλὰ βασιλέων, ἐθνῶν πάντοθεν συνιόντων, κυκλούντων, πολιορκούντων πόλιν μίαν, οὐ μόνον οὐδὲν ἔπαθεν ὑπ' αὐτῶν δεινὸν, ἀλλὰ καὶ περιεγένετο, καὶ ἐκράτησε, καὶ περιέτρεψε τοὺς ἐπιόντας
因為所面對的並非尋常的來犯者,而是列王,是從四面八方聚集而來的列國,圍困並攻打一座城;然而他不僅絲毫未受他們的傷害,反倒得勝、掌權,並傾覆了那些來犯的人。
For it was not against ordinary assailants, but against kings, with nations gathering from every side, encircling and besieging a single city, that he not only suffered nothing dreadful at their hands, but even prevailed, gained the mastery, and overthrew those who assailed him.
17:68
Τοῦτο γάρ ἐστι τὸ, Ἔκλιναν βασιλεῖαι, ἔδωκε φωνὴν αὐτοῦ Ὕψιστος·
因為這正是「列國傾倒了;至高者發出祂的聲音」這話的意思。
For this is what is meant by, 'Kingdoms were bowed down; He gave forth His voice, the Most High.'
17:69
ὡς ἂν εἴποι τις, Αὐτοβοεὶ. τὰς πόλεις εἷλε
正如有人可能會說的,祂在初次的吶喊之間便攻取了那些城。
As one might say, He took the cities at the first shout.
17:70
Παχὺ μὲν τὸ ῥῆμα, καὶ ἀνθρωπινώτερον τὸ εἰρημένον
這說法是粗略的,所言也頗為擬人化。
The expression is coarse, and what is said is rather too human.
17:71
Οὐδὲ γὰρ φωνῇ καὶ βοῇ Θεὸς νικᾷ, ἀλλὰ νεύματι μόνῳ καὶ βουλήματι
因為神並非藉聲音和吶喊得勝,而是僅憑一個示意和祂的旨意。
For God does not conquer by voice and shouting, but by a mere nod and by His will.
17:72
Ἀλλ' ὅμως ἀπὸ τῶν παχυτέρων αὐτὸν ἀνάγων, τῶν ἄλλων ὑψηλοτέραν ἐπενόησε λέξιν
然而,他將人從那些較為粗淺的觀念引領上升,構思出一個比其餘更為崇高的說法。
Nevertheless, leading him up from the coarser conceptions, he devised an expression loftier than the rest.
17:73
Ἐπειδὴ γὰρ ἀεὶ ὁπλιζόμενον αὐτὸν εἰσάγει, δεικνὺς ὅτι πάντα ἐκεῖνα μεταφορικῶς εἴρηται, καὶ τροπικώτερον, καὶ συγκαταβατικώτερον γὰρ Θεὸς οὐδενὸς τούτων δεῖται, ἐπήγαγεν, Ἔδωκε φωνὴν αὐτοῦ, καὶ ἐσαλεύθη γῆ·
因為他不斷把神引介為武裝自己的形象,藉此表明所有那些事都是以譬喻的方式說出的,且更是以象徵的、俯就人的方式而言的——因為神並不需要這些事中的任何一樣——於是他接著說:「祂發出祂的聲音,地就震動了」;
For since he continually introduces Him as arming Himself, showing that all those things are spoken metaphorically, and rather figuratively, and by way of condescension—for God needs none of these things—he added, 'He gave forth His voice, and the earth was shaken';
17:74
δεικνὺς, ὅτι οὐ μόνον πόλεις, καὶ ἔθνη, καὶ χώρας, ἀλλὰ καὶ αὐτὸ τὸ στοιχεῖον διασείει
藉此顯明祂所震動的不僅是城邑、列國和地域,甚至連那元素本身也震動。
showing that He shakes not only cities and nations and lands, but the very element itself.
17:75
Οἶδε δὲ καὶ γῆν τὰ πλήθη καλεῖν, ὡς ὅταν λέγῃ·
他也懂得將眾多的人群稱為「地」,正如他所說的:
He knows also how to call the multitudes 'earth,' as when he says:
17:76
Καὶ ἦν πᾶσα γῆ χεῖλος ἔν
「全地都是一種口音」——即一種語言。
'And the whole earth was of one lip'—that is, one language.
17:77
Κύριος τῶν δυνάμεων μεθ' ἡμῶν
「萬軍之耶和華與我們同在。」
'The Lord of hosts is with us.'
17:78
Ἀντιλήπτωρ ἡμῶν Θεὸς Ἰακώβ
「雅各的神是我們的幫助。」
'The God of Jacob is our helper.'
17:79
δὲ Ἑβραῖος ἀντὶτοῦ, Τῶν δυνάμεων, Σαβαὼθ εἶπεν
但希伯來文則不用「萬軍」,而說「撒巴俄特」。
But the Hebrew, instead of 'of hosts,' said 'Sabaoth.'
17:80
Ὅρα πῶς ἀπὸ τῆς γῆς ἀνάγει τὸν λόγον ἐπὶ τὸν οὐρανὸν, εἰς τοὺς ἀπείρους τῶν ἀγγέλων δήμους, εἰς τὰ ἔθνη τῶν ἀρχαγγέλων, εἰς τὰς δυνάμεις τὰς ἄνω
你看他如何將這番論述從地上引領到天上,引向那無數的天使群眾,引向眾天使長的族類,引向那在上的諸權能。
See how he leads the discourse up from the earth to heaven, to the boundless multitudes of the angels, to the nations of the archangels, to the powers above.
17:81
Τί γάρ μοι λέγεις στρατόπεδα, καὶ βαρβάρους, καὶ ἀνθρώπους ἀπολλυμένους; φησίν
他說:「你為何向我提說軍隊、蠻族,和那些將要滅亡的人呢?」
'Why do you speak to me of armies, and barbarians, and perishing men?' he says.
17:82
Ἐννόησον αὐτοῦ τὴν ἰσχὺν, ἀπὸ τῆς ἐν τοῖς οὐρανοῖς βασιλείας, ὅσα στρατόπεδα τῶν ἀοράτων δυνάμεων ὑφ' ἑαυτῷ τεταγμένα ἔχει
當從祂在諸天之上的國度來思想祂的能力——祂在自己之下所部署的那些不可見之權能的軍隊何其多。
Consider His might from His kingdom in the heavens—how many armies of the invisible powers He has arrayed under Himself.
17:83
Καὶ καλῶς δυνάμεις ἐκάλεσε, τὴν ἰσχὺν αὐτῶν ἐνδεικνύμενος·
他稱他們為「權能」,實在恰當,藉以指明他們的能力;
And well did he call them 'powers,' indicating their might;
17:84
Δυνατοὶ ἰσχύϊ, ποιοῦντες τὸν λόγον αὐτοῦ
「大有能力、遵行祂命令的。」
'Mighty in strength, performing His word.'
17:85
Καὶ γὰρ εἷς ἄγγελός ποτε ἐξελθὼν, ἑκατὸν ὀγδοήκοντα πέντε χιλιάδας ἀνεῖλε
因為確有一位天使曾出去,擊殺了十八萬五千人。
For indeed a single angel once went forth and slew a hundred and eighty-five thousand.
17:86
Τί οὖν εἰ δυνατὸς μέν ἐστιν, οὐ βούλεται δὲ ἡμῖν χεῖρα ὀρέξαι; Ἀλλὰ μηδὲ τοῦτο δείσῃς, φησί·
「那麼,若祂固然有能力,卻不願向我們伸出手來,又當如何呢?」他說:「這也不用懼怕」;
'What then, if He is indeed mighty, but is unwilling to stretch out His hand to us?' 'But do not fear this either,' he says;
17:87
διὰ τοῦτο ἐπήγαγεν, Ἀντιλήπτωρ ἡμῶν
因此他接著說:「我們的幫助」。
for this reason he added, 'our helper.'
17:88
Οὐκοῦν καὶ βούλεται καὶ δύναται·
所以祂既願意,又有能力。
Therefore He both wills and is able.
17:89
Τί οὖν εἰ ἡμεῖς ἀνάξιοι; Ἀλλὰ πατρῴαν πρὸς αὐτὸν ἔχομεν φιλανθρωπίαν
「那麼,若我們不配,又當如何呢?」「然而我們從祂得著父親般的慈愛。」
'What then, if we are unworthy?' 'But we have from Him a fatherly loving-kindness.'
17:90
Διὸ καὶ τοῦτο προστιθεὶς ἔλεγεν, Θεὸς Ἰακὼβ, ὡσανεὶ ἔλεγεν·
因此他也加上這句話,說:「雅各的神」,彷彿是說:
Wherefore, adding this too, he said, 'the God of Jacob,' as though he were saying:
17:91
Ἀεὶ τοῦτο τὸ ἔθοςαὐτῷ, φησὶν, ἄνωθεν, καὶ ἐξ ἀρχῆς
他說:「這向來就是祂的慣常之道,從亙古、從起初便是如此。」
'This has always been His custom,' he says, 'from of old and from the beginning.'
17:92
Δεῦτε καὶ ἴδετε τὰ ἔργα τοῦ Θεοῦ, ἔθετο τέρατα ἐπὶ τῆς γῆς, ἀνταναιρῶν πολέμους μέχρι τῶν περάτων τῆς γῆς
「你們來看神的作為,就是祂在地上所立的奇事,止息刀兵直到地極。」
'Come and see the works of God, the wonders which He has set upon the earth, putting an end to wars unto the ends of the earth.'
17:93
Τόξον συντρίψει, καὶ συνθλάσει ὅπλον ἄλλος λέγει, Συνέκλασε, καὶ θυρεοὺς κατακαύσει ἐν πυρί
「祂要折斷弓,砍斷兵器」——另一位譯者說:「祂折斷了它們」——「並要用火焚燒盾牌。」
'He will shatter the bow and break the weapon in pieces'—another says, 'He broke them asunder'—'and He will burn up the shields in the fire.'
17:94
Ἄλλος, Καὶ ἁμάξας ἐμπρήσει ἐν πυρί
另一位譯者說:「祂要用火焚燒戰車。」
Another says, 'And He will burn the wagons in the fire.'
17:95
Εἰπὼν περὶ τῆς γῆς, περὶ τῆς θαλάσσης, περὶ τῶν ὀρῶν, περὶ τῆς πνευματικῆς χορηγίας τῆς εἰς αὐτοὺς γεγενημένης, περὶ τῆς συμμαχίας, πάλιν ἐκτείνει τὴν ὑπόθεσιν πρὸς τοὺς θεατὰς, ἐπὶ τὰ τρόπαια αὐτοὺς καλῶν ἐξ ἡδονῆς πολλῆς, καὶ τῆς πρὸς τὸν Δεσπότην διαθέσεως, καὶ τὰς νίκας ἀναγορεύων, ἃς ὑπὲρ αὐτῶν εἰργάσατο
他既已論及地、論及海、論及群山、論及臨到他們身上的屬靈供應、論及那援助之後,便再次將這主題向觀看的人展開,出於極大的喜樂、出於他們向主的心意,召喚他們前來察看那些戰利品,並高聲宣揚祂為他們所成就的種種勝利。
Having spoken about the earth, about the sea, about the mountains, about the spiritual supply that had come to them, about the alliance, he again extends the theme toward the spectators, calling them to the trophies out of much gladness and out of their disposition toward the Master, and proclaiming aloud the victories which He wrought on their behalf.
17:96
Καὶ καλῶς εἶπε, Τέρατα, οὐκ εἶπε, νίκας καὶ τρόπαια
他說「奇事」,而不說「勝利和戰利品」,實在恰當。
And well did he say 'wonders,' and did not say 'victories and trophies.'
17:97
Οὐ γὰρ κατὰ ἀκολουθίαν ἐγίνετο
因為所發生的事並非按照尋常的因果次序而成就的——
For it did not come about in the ordinary course of events—
17:98
τὰ γινόμενα, οὐδὲ ὅπλοις καὶ δυνάμει σωμάτων τὰ τῆς μάχης ἐκρίνετο, ἀλλὰ Θεοῦ νεύματι, τῶν πραγμάτων δηλούντων, ὅτι αὐτὸς ἦν στρατηγῶν
那些發生的事並非如此;戰事的結局也不是由兵器和肉身的力量所決定,而是由神的示意所定,事情本身表明那位統帥正是祂。
the things that took place; nor were the outcomes of the battle decided by weapons and bodily strength, but by the nod of God, the events themselves making clear that it was He who was the commander.
17:99
Ἐπειδὴ γὰρ οἱ ἀσθενεῖς τοὺς δυνατοὺς ἐνίκων, οἱ ὀλίγοι τοὺς πολλοὺς, οἱ κεκρατημένοι τοὺς κρατοῦντας, καὶ παρ' ἐλπίδα τὰ πράγματα ἐγίνετο, εἰκότως αὐτὰ τέρατα καλεῖ, ἅτε παραδόξως συμβαίνοντα, καὶ πανταχοῦ τῆς γῆς ἐκτεταμένα
因為軟弱的勝過強壯的,稀少的勝過眾多的,被制伏的勝過制伏人的,事情的結果又出人意料,所以他恰當地稱這些為「奇事」,因為它們是以出人意表的方式發生的,並且遍及地上各處。
For since the weak overcame the strong, the few the many, the vanquished the victors, and matters turned out contrary to expectation, he fittingly calls them 'wonders,' inasmuch as they came to pass paradoxically and were extended everywhere throughout the earth.
17:100
Τοῦτο δὲ οὐκ ἄν τις ἁμάρτοι καὶ κατὰ ἀναγωγὴν ἐκλαβὼν, καὶ εἰς τὸν παρόντα καιρόν
若有人也從屬靈提升的意義上來領會這話,並將其應用於現今的時代,也不算錯。
One would not err in taking this also in an anagogical sense, and as applying to the present time.
17:101
Καὶ γὰρ πόλεμον χαλεπὸν κατέλυσε τὸν τῶν δαιμόνων, καὶ παντα. χοῦ τῆς οἰκουμένης τὴν εἰρήνην ἐξέτεινε, καὶ τὸν αἰσθητὸν δὲ αὐτῶν πόλεμον συγκατέβαλεν
因為祂確實止息了眾魔鬼那場慘烈的爭戰,並在普天之下的世界廣施平安,同時也一併傾覆了他們那可見的爭戰。
For indeed He put an end to the grievous war of the demons, and throughout the whole inhabited world He extended peace, and He also overthrew their perceptible war along with it.
17:102
Ὅπερ καὶ Ἡσαΐας δηλῶν ἔλεγε·
以賽亞也明明地宣告這事,說:
This is what Isaiah also declared when he said:
17:103
Συντρίψουσι τὰς μαχαίρας αὐτῶν εἰς ἄροτρα, καὶ τὰς ζιβύνας αὐτῶν εἰς δρέπανα, καὶ οὐ λήψεται ἔθνος ἐπ' ἔθνος μάχαιραν, καὶ οὐ μὴ μάθωσιν ἔτι πολεμεῖν
他們要將刀打成犁頭,把槍打成鐮刀;這國不再向那國動刀,他們也不再學習戰事。
They shall beat their swords into ploughshares, and their spears into pruning-hooks; and nation shall not take up sword against nation, neither shall they learn war any more.
17:104
Πρὸ μὲν γὰρ τῆς τοῦ Χριστοῦ παρουσίας πάντες ἄνθρωποι ὅπλα ἐτίθεντο, καὶ οὐδεὶς ἀτελὴς ταύτης τῆς λειτουργίας ἦν, καὶ πόλεις πρὸς τὰς πόλεις ἐμάχοντο, καὶ διόλου τὰ τῶν πολέμων συνεκροτεῖτο·
因為在基督降臨之前,人人都拿起兵器,沒有一個人可以免除這種差役,城邑與城邑彼此爭戰,戰爭之事處處被挑起;
For before the coming of Christ all men took up arms, and no one was exempt from this service, and cities warred against cities, and the affairs of war were being stirred up throughout everything;
17:105
νῦν δὲ τὸ πλέον τῆς οἰκουμένης ἐν εἰρήνῃ, πάντων ἐν ἀδείᾳ καὶ τέχνας μετιόντων, καὶ γῆν ἐργαζομένων, καὶ θάλατταν πλεόντων·
但如今普天下大部分的地方都處於太平,眾人安然無懼地從事各樣技藝,耕種田地,航行海洋;
but now the greater part of the inhabited world is at peace, while all men pursue their crafts in security, tilling the land and sailing the sea;
17:106
ὀλίγον δέ ἐστι τὸ στρατιωτικὸν πρὸ τῶν ἄλλων ἁπάντων τεταγμένον
而那列陣在眾人之前的軍旅,不過是少數而已。
and the soldiery, drawn up before all the rest, is but a small thing.
17:107
Καὶ τούτου δὲ ἂν χρεία κατελύθη, εἰ τὰ προσήκοντα ἐπράττομεν, καὶ μὴ ἐδεόμεθα τῆς ἀπὸ τῶν θλίψεων ὑπομνήσεως
倘若我們行所當行的事,不需要那從患難而來的提醒,就連這少數軍旅的需要也必被廢除了。
And even the need of this would have been abolished, if we did what befitted us, and did not require the reminder that comes from afflictions.
17:108
Πῦρ δὲ ἐνταῦθα τὴν ὀργὴν αὐτοῦ καλεῖ, καὶ πρᾶγμα συμβεβηκὸς λέγει, ὅτι τὰ ὅπλα αὐτῶν κατέκαυσαν, κατὰ κράτος νικήσαντες, καὶ τὰ ἅρματα, ὅπερ Ἰεζεκιήλ φησι·
在這裡他把神的憤怒稱為「火」,並且述說一件已成就的事,就是他們大大得勝,焚燒了敵人的兵器和戰車,正如以西結所說的:
Here he calls His wrath 'fire,' and he speaks of a thing that came to pass, namely that they burned up their weapons, having conquered by main force, and the chariots too, which is what Ezekiel says:
17:109
καὶ ὅσοι φιλομαθεῖς, ἴσασι τὴν ἱστορίαν
凡好學的人都曉得這段歷史。
and as many as are lovers of learning know the history.
17:110
Σχολάσατε, καὶ γνῶτε, ὅτι ἐγώ εἰμι Θεός
你們要休息,要知道我是神。
Be still, and know that I am God.
17:111
Ὑψωθήσομαι ἐν τοῖς ἔθνεσι, ὑψωθήσομαι ἐν τῇ γῇ
我必在列國中被尊崇,我必在遍地被尊崇。
I will be exalted among the nations, I will be exalted in the earth.
17:112
Ἄλλος φησὶν, Ἰάθητε καὶ γνῶτε
另一種譯法作:你們要得醫治,並且要知道。
Another renders it: Be healed, and know.
17:113
δὲ Ἑβραῖός φησιν, Οὐαρφοῦ οὐαδοῦ
希伯來原文則作:「Ouarphou ouadou」。
And the Hebrew says: 'Ouarphou ouadou.'
17:114
Ἐνταῦθά μοι δοκεῖ πρὸς τὰ ἔθνη διαλέγεσθαι, μονονουχὶ τοῦτο λέγων·
在這裡我看來,他是在向列國說話,簡直就是在說這話:
Here it seems to me that He is discoursing to the nations, all but saying this:
17:115
Ἔγνωτε μὲν αὐτοῦ τὴν ἰσχὺν, φησὶ, καὶ τὴν δύναμιν τὴν πανταχοῦ τῆς οἰκουμένης ἐκτεταμένην·
他說,你們確已認識他的力量,以及他那伸展到普天下各處的大能;
You have indeed come to know His strength, He says, and His power that is stretched out over every part of the inhabited world;
17:116
δεῖ δὲ ὑμῖν σχολῆς, δεῖ δὲ ὑμῖν ὑγιαινούσης ψυχῆς
但你們需要安靜,你們需要一個健全的靈魂。
but you have need of stillness, you have need of a sound soul.
17:117
Καὶ τὸ Ἐάσατε δὲ τὸ αὐτὸ δηλοῖ·
而那「任憑」一詞也表明同樣的意思:
And the word 'Let be' signifies the same thing:
17:118
ἄφετε τὴν πλάνην, ἀπαλλάγητε τῆς προτέρας ἀναστροφῆς, ἀναπνεύσατε ἐκ τῆς ἀχλύος τῶν κατεχόντων ὑμᾶς πονηρῶν πραγμάτων, ἵνα ἀπὸ τῆς τῶν θαυμάτων διδασκαλίας χειραγωγούμενοι καὶ τὴν ψυχὴν σχολάζουσαν ἔχοντες, ἐπιγνῶτε τὸν τῶν ὅλων Θεόν
要撇棄迷惑,脫離從前的生活方式,從那捆住你們之惡事的迷霧中透一口氣,好叫你們藉著神蹟的教訓被牽引前行,並使靈魂得享安息,便能認識那萬有之神。
let go of your error, be delivered from your former manner of life, take breath from the mist of the wicked affairs that hold you fast, so that, being led by the hand through the teaching of the miracles and keeping your soul at rest, you may come to recognize the God of all things.
17:119
Οὐδὲ γὰρ ἀρκεῖ τὰ θαύματα μόνον, ἐὰν μὴ καὶ ψυχὴ εὐγνώμων
因為單有神蹟並不足夠,除非靈魂也存著感恩順服的心。
For the miracles alone do not suffice, unless the soul also be well-disposed.
17:120
Ἐπεὶ καὶ ἐπὶ τῶν Ἰουδαίων ἐγένετο θαύματα, καὶ οὐδὲν πλέον ἐγένετο πρὸς τὴν σωτηρίαν ἐκείνων
因為在猶太人中間也曾有神蹟發生,卻對他們的得救毫無益處。
Since among the Jews too miracles took place, and yet nothing more was accomplished toward their salvation.
17:121
Ὥσπερ γὰρ οὐκ ἀρκοῦσιν αἱ τοῦ ἡλίου ἀκτῖνες, ἐὰν μὴ καὶ ὀφθαλμὸς καθαρὸς , καὶ ὑγιαίνων·
正如日光並不足夠,除非眼睛也是潔淨而健康的;
For just as the rays of the sun do not suffice, unless the eye also be clean and healthy,
17:122
οὕτω δὴ οὐδὲ ἐνταῦθα τὰ θαύματα μόνον ἀρκεῖ
照樣,在此處單有神蹟也是不夠的。
even so here also the miracles alone do not suffice.
17:123
Διὸ δὴ περὶ ἐκείνων διαλεχθεὶς, παραινεῖ τοῖς μέλλουσιν αὐτῶν καρποῦσθαι τὴν ὠφέλειαν, ἀναπνεῦσαι ἐκ τῶν κατεχόντων αὐτοὺς κακῶν, ὥστε μαθεῖν τὸν Θεὸν τὸν ἐπὶ τῶν ὅλων
因此,他既論到那些事,就勸勉那些將要從中得益處的人,要從捆住他們的諸惡中透一口氣,好認識那超乎萬有之上的神。
Therefore, having discoursed concerning those things, He exhorts those who are about to reap the benefit from them to take breath from the evils that hold them fast, so as to learn the God who is over all things.
17:124
Σχολάσατε, καὶ γνῶτε, ὅτι ἐγώ εἰμι Θεὸς, οὐ τὰ εἴδωλα, οὐδὲ τὰ ξόανα
你們要休息,要知道我是神—不是偶像,也不是雕刻的像。
Be still, and know that I am God—not the idols, nor the carved images.
17:125
Σχολάσατε τοίνυν, καὶ πολλὰς ὑμῖν παρέξομαι τὰς ἀποδείξεις
所以你們要安靜,我必將許多憑據賜給你們。
Be still, therefore, and I will furnish you with many proofs.
17:126
Τοῦτο γάρ ἐστι τὸ, Ὑψωθήσομαι ἐν τοῖς ἔθνεσιν, ὑψωθήσομαι ἐν τῇ γῇ·
因為「我必在列國中被尊崇,我必在遍地被尊崇」這話的意思就是這樣;
For this is the meaning of, 'I will be exalted among the nations, I will be exalted in the earth';
17:127
τουτέστι, Διὰ τῶν ἔργων ὑμῖν δειχθήσομαι μέγας καὶ ὑψηλός
也就是說:我必藉著我的作為,向你們顯明我是至大至高的。
that is to say: Through My works I shall be shown to you to be great and lofty.
17:128
Ἔχει μὲν γὰρ τὸ οἰκεῖον φύσις ὕψος, ἀκήρατος ἐκείνη καὶ ἄφραστος
因為那本性本有其自身固有的高崇—就是那純潔而不可言喻的本性。
For that nature possesses its own proper height—that pure and inexpressible nature.
17:129
Ἐπειδὴ δὲ τοῦτο ὑμεῖς οὐ συνορᾶτε, καὶ διὰ τῶν ἔργων ὑμῖν αὐτὸ ἐπιδείξω
但既然你們看不透這一點,我就要藉著我的作為向你們顯明出來。
But since you do not perceive this, I will also demonstrate it to you through My works.
17:130
Οὐ μόνον δὲ ἐν τῇ Παλαιστίνῃ, οὐδὲ μόνον ἐν Ἱεροσολύμοις, ἀλλὰ καὶ παρ' ὑμῖν τοῖς ἔθνεσιν
不單在巴勒斯坦,也不單在耶路撒冷,乃是也在你們列國之中。
And not only in Palestine, nor only in Jerusalem, but also among you, the nations.
17:131
Οὕτω γοῦν ὑψοῦται, κρατῶν αὐτῶν καὶ περιγινόμενος, θαύματα ἐργαζόμενος ἐν Βαβυλῶνι, θαύματα ἐν Αἰγύπτῳ, θαύματα ἐν ἐρήμῳ, θαύματα πανταχοῦ τῆς οἰκουμένης, ὡς πανταχόθεν αὐτοὺς διδασκαλίαν ἔχειν τῆς αὐτοῦ γνώσεως
他正是這樣被尊崇,制伏並勝過他們,在巴比倫行神蹟,在埃及行神蹟,在曠野行神蹟,在普天下各處行神蹟,好使他們從各方面都得著認識他的教訓。
In this way indeed is He exalted, mastering them and prevailing over them, working miracles in Babylon, miracles in Egypt, miracles in the wilderness, miracles in every part of the inhabited world, so that from every quarter they might have instruction in the knowledge of Him.
17:132
Κύριος τῶν δυνάμεων μεθ' ἡμῶν, ἀντιλήπτωρ ἡμῶν Θεὸς Ἰακώβ
萬軍之耶和華與我們同在,雅各的神是我們的避難所。
The Lord of hosts is with us; the God of Jacob is our helper.
17:133
Οὗτος τοίνυν . Θεὸς, πανταχοῦ μέγας, πανταχοῦ ὑψηλὸς, οὗτος ἀεὶ μεθ' ἡμῶν ἕστηκε
那麼,這位神,這處處為大、處處崇高的神,他常與我們同立。
This God, then, who is everywhere great, everywhere lofty, this One stands ever with us.
17:134
φοβεῖσθε, μηδὲ ταράσσεσθε, οὕτως ἔχοντες ἄμαχον Δεσπότην·
既有這樣一位無可匹敵的主宰,你們就不要懼怕,也不要驚慌;
Fear not, neither be troubled, since you have such an invincible Master;
17:135
πρέπει πᾶσα τιμὴ καὶ δόξα σὺν τῷ ἀνάρχῳ Πατρὶ καὶ ζωοποιῷ αὐτοῦ Πνεύματι, νῦν καὶ ἀεὶ, καὶ εἰς τοὺς αἰῶνας τῶν αἰώνων
願一切尊貴榮耀都歸與他,並歸與那無始的父,和他賜生命的靈,從今直到永永遠遠。阿們。
to whom belongs all honour and glory, together with the Father who is without beginning, and His life-giving Spirit, now and ever, and unto the ages of ages. Amen.
